Section Sch2-4 — Property Law Act 2007: Obligations in respect of mortgaged land
Text of the provision Official document
4 Obligations in respect of mortgaged land The mortgagor will— (a) pay all rates, taxes, and charges for the mortgaged land as and when they become due; and (b) perform all duties and obligations imposed on the owner or occupier of the mortgaged land concerning the land, including (without limitation) all obligations binding on the owner or occupier of the land under— (i) the Resource Management Act 1991 or any consent given, or any notice, order, or requirement made, under that Act or under the rules of any regional or district plan; and (ii) the Building Act 2004 or any building consent given under that Act; and (c) comply with all notices and demands relating to the mortgaged land made under the provisions of any other enactment, ordinance, or bylaw. Compare: 1952 No 51 Schedule 4 cl 3
